Celta Vigo vs Real Madrid: A Clash of Form and Expectations
Prior Expectations
As the La Liga clash between Celta Vigo and Real Madrid approaches, expectations were high for both teams. Celta Vigo, currently sitting sixth in the league table, had been on a remarkable run, securing four consecutive wins across all competitions. Their recent form included a notable 2-1 victory against Girona, showcasing their attacking prowess, particularly in the second half where 72% of their league goals have been scored. Meanwhile, Real Madrid, despite a strong start to the season, had lost two consecutive matches, leaving them four points behind rivals Barcelona and raising concerns about their consistency.
Decisive Moments
The decisive moment for Celta Vigo came with their recent performances, particularly their 2-0 win at the Santiago Bernabeu in December, which set a precedent for their confidence going into this match. In contrast, Real Madrid’s struggles were highlighted by their inability to secure wins, with their last match resulting in a disappointing performance where they managed only an xG total of 1.11 against Osasuna. The stakes are high for Real Madrid, who have been urged to treat this match as a must-win, especially given the challenging atmosphere at Balaídos.
Direct Effects on the Teams
The contrasting fortunes of the two teams have direct implications for their upcoming encounter. Celta Vigo’s recent successes have bolstered their morale and positioned them as a formidable opponent, while Real Madrid’s recent losses have led to increased pressure on their squad. With three players unavailable due to suspension, including their only senior centre-back not dealing with fitness issues, Real Madrid’s defensive lineup will be tested against a Celta Vigo side that has been effective in capitalizing on opportunities.
